Listening to children is a skill that parents, teachers, caregivers, and school counselors need to use every day. Through their deep respect for the existing attitudes of these adults, the authors offer an additional dimension to the art of communicating with children.

This book addresses listening in many ways, both to our deeper selves and to others. It involves listening to what children say, feel, and think, but also to what lies deeper than thoughts and emotions.

When children learn to listen to their inner world, sensing what they feel in their bodies, a change in behavior emerges. The process of change, called Focusing, is explained in many ways, through the personal experiences of the authors, their workshops, training, and through therapy sessions with children.

The authors provide a structured approach to applying this process in schools and other group situations, but much of it can also be utilized at home by parents. With this book, you can quite independently begin to accompany children more consciously in their development, and in this way, you will see their self-confidence grow.
